|  |  |  | 
|---|
|  |  |  | .eq(Member::getPhone,checkVisitedDTO.getMobile()) | 
|---|
|  |  |  | .eq(validType.equals(Constants.ONE),Member::getName,checkVisitedDTO.getName()) | 
|---|
|  |  |  | .eq(Member::getIsdeleted,Constants.ZERO) | 
|---|
|  |  |  | .eq(Member::getStatus,Constants.ZERO) | 
|---|
|  |  |  | //                .eq(Member::getStatus,Constants.ZERO) | 
|---|
|  |  |  | .eq(Member::getCanVisit,Constants.ONE) | 
|---|
|  |  |  | .eq(Member::getType,Constants.memberType.internal) | 
|---|
|  |  |  | .last(" limit 1 ") | 
|---|
|  |  |  | ); | 
|---|
|  |  |  | MemberVO memberVO = new MemberVO(); | 
|---|
|  |  |  | if(!Objects.isNull(member)){ | 
|---|
|  |  |  | if(!member.getStatus().equals(Constants.ZERO)){ | 
|---|
|  |  |  | throw new BusinessException(ResponseStatus.NOT_ALLOWED.getCode(),"被访人账号异常,请确认后再试"); | 
|---|
|  |  |  | } | 
|---|
|  |  |  | BeanUtils.copyProperties(member,memberVO); | 
|---|
|  |  |  | }else{ | 
|---|
|  |  |  | throw new BusinessException(ResponseStatus.DATA_EMPTY); | 
|---|